PASSIONFRUIT SYRUP

Makes one cup of sweet aromatic syrup. Use on ice-cream, fruit salads or to flavor custards.

12 large passionfruits
1 1/2 cups sugar

1/2 cup water.

Halve passionfruit and scoop pulp into a sieve. Rub through the sieve to separate juice and seeds.
Discard the seeds and measure juice to get at least 100ml.
In a saucepan mix sugar and water and stir to dissolve. Bring the mixture to boil for 5 minutes or until syrup thickens enough to form a thread when dropped from the tines of a fork.

Add passionfruit juice and return to boil for a minute or two.

Pour into small, clean, hot, dry jars or bottles seal while hot.
